{-# LANGUAGE CPP #-}
#if !defined(mingw32_HOST_OS)
{-# LANGUAGE TemplateHaskell #-}
{-# OPTIONS_GHC -Wno-orphans #-}
#endif
module TextShow.System.Posix () where
#if !defined(mingw32_HOST_OS)
import System.Posix.DynamicLinker (RTLDFlags, DL)
import System.Posix.Process (ProcessStatus)
import System.Posix.User (GroupEntry, UserEntry)
import TextShow.TH (deriveTextShow)
$(deriveTextShow ''RTLDFlags)
$(deriveTextShow ''DL)
$(deriveTextShow ''ProcessStatus)
$(deriveTextShow ''GroupEntry)
$(deriveTextShow ''UserEntry)
#endif